Public funding for political campaigns would go a long way to reducing the influence of the big money corporations on members of Congressl. The special interests such as insurance firms and oil companies are able to prevent passage of meaningful health care reform, and measures to address global warming, both supported by a majority of the people. Fair elections would allow the people not dollars to have their true voice. And it would allow politicians time to work on the issues rather than dialing for dollars.
A hybrid system including 4:1 matching of small donations or full public financing- either would be a huge improvement in our democracy.
